Rep. Severin: Secretary of State Extends International Registration Plan Deadline to April 18

BENTON, IL – State Representative Dave Severin (R-Benton) is reminding farm and commercial truck drivers and businesses of a deadline extension provided by the Illinois Secretary of State for truck registration. Due to staffing issues, the Secretary of State’s office extended the registration deadline for farm and commercial trucks to April 18, 2025.

“Last weekend I worked very closely with truck drivers and the Illinois Secretary of State’s office to understand and address an issue of great importance to our farmers and truck driving industry,” Severin said. “I am grateful to the Secretary of State’s office for extending the registration deadline for these vehicles and for urging law enforcement to refrain from writing tickets for expired registrations until the deadline extension has ended,” Severid said. “This outcome means our farmers and truck-driving businesses will be protected as they work to get their vehicles registered.”
